A nurse is developing a surveillance guide to assist with monitoring for bioterrorist attacks. Which of the following situations should the nurse include as an indication of possible bioterrorism?
Report of rash and fever among over half the attendees at a recent college sports event
Report of four cases of tuberculosis among inmates residing at a correctional facility
Report of five cases of Fifth disease among preschoolers at a local day care facility
Report of increased national incidences of pertussis following decreased immunization rates
The Correct Answer is A
Choice A reason: A sudden outbreak of illness with symptoms like rash and fever among a large group of people in a specific location could indicate a bioterrorism event.
Choice B reason: Tuberculosis is a known infectious disease that can occur in places with close living quarters, like correctional facilities, and is not typically associated with bioterrorism.
Choice C reason: Fifth disease is a common viral illness in children and is not considered an indicator of bioterrorism.
Choice D reason: A national increase in pertussis cases is likely related to decreased immunization rates rather than
bioterrorism.
